Job description

We have an exciting opportunity for an enthusiastic and dedicated Band 6 Autism Assessor who is a qualified Nurse, Occupational Therapist or Speech & Language Therapist to join our growing team in BSW, with a base at Swindon Health Centre.

As a Band 6 Autism Assessor, you will provide assessment and post diagnostic support to both individuals and groups as appropriate with supervision available for formulation and diagnosis following assessment.

Primarily based in Bath, you will have the flexibility to work within a model that supports both on-site and hybrid working arrangements, depending on the nature of the role. HCRG Care Group is committed to fostering an agile and adaptable workforce to best meet the needs of our organisation and service users.

Some travel across the BSW patch may be required so willingness to travel and a full UK driving license and access to a vehicle is essential.

Previous experience and training in relevant autism assessment tools is vital to this role.

Main duties of the job

Main responsibilities of the role include, but are not limited to, the following:

  • To provide a service to the designated team including assessment and post diagnostic support to both individuals and groups as appropriate. Supervision will be available for formulation and diagnosis following assessment.
  • To provide a specialist consultancy service to mental health teams and other agencies providing care for the client group.
  • To participate in generic team duties as agreed by the Team manager as appropriate, to the needs of the service.
  • To participate in clinical and caseload supervision arrangements provided by the team.
  • To maintain accurate records and to monitor clinical workload using agreed systems.

A full list of responsibilities can be found in the attached job description.

The Ideal Candidate

The ideal candidate will meet the following essential criteria:

Recognised qualification in Occupational Therapy, Nursing or Speech and Language Therapy

Current HCPC or NMC Registration

Demonstrates substantial post-registration experience gained working in a range of front-line adult mental health services, undertaking assessment and delivering interventions

Experience of working in an autism service/team or Mental Health Team where some service users had autism.

Knowledge of autism assessments and appropriate services

Effective team player with good communication and liaison skills.

Well organised with good administration skills.

Empathy/engagement skills with the client group.

Ability to cope with workload pressure/prioritise workload.

Ability to work independently.

Self-awareness and emotional resilience.
